sep 4, 1828 - Revolution of 1828

Description:

Adams was seeking reelection in 1828, but the Jacksonians were ready and were going to use the discontent of the southerners to their advantage. Rather than going to parades to campaign, the Jacksonians smeared President Adams reputation saying his wife was born out of wedlock, while supporters of Adams claimed Jacksons wife had committed adultery. The mudslinging of these campaigns attracted the most attention and increased voter turnout. Jackson ended up winning the Presidency securing the votes in the Western states.
